Beth was born with a severe brittle bone disorder called Osteogenesis Imperfecta Type III.
 
Since birth she has had over a hundred broken bones and countless treatments and operations. Beth has spent months in hospital in traction, or in full body casts, and experienced a whole world of pain. She has limited mobility and is wheelchair reliant.
 
Beth has many other physical conditions linked to her disorder that are likely to worsen in the future. One of these was that her spine was moving up into her skull.
 
In August she was admitted to hospital for an operation and was recovering at home until she was rushed to Westmead Children’s Hospital with acute pain. It was discovered that, in layman’s terms, her head had fallen off her spine.
 
After three further surgeries, Beth has now lost the mobility and independence she had, and it is unknown how much movement or strength will return, or when.
